Falconer makes site fit for press

Falconer Print and Packaging is preparing for the arrival of a Heidelberg press this month.

The 35-staff firm is drilling foundation piles into its factory floor in Elland, West Yorkshire, to accommodate the Speedmaster CD74-6L-F UV machine.

It will produce short runs of small cartons for pharma and cosmetics firms at speeds of 15,000 cartons an hour and average runs of 5,000.

The Speedmaster replaces a five-colour Roland 600 B1 press at the £2.5m-turnover firm. Heidelberg had the technological edge on Roland and was “very proactive towards installation”, said managing director Hadyn Bradbury.
